Famous Pie In Hawaii

What kind of pie is Hawaii most famous for?

Hawaii is famous for the Hula Pie! This pie originated at Kimo's restaurant in Hawaii. But it was made famous at Duke's. Its real name is “Kimo's Original Hula Pie,” and it is even labeled as such on the menu at Duke's. This is a pie that you’ll want to try the next time you’re at Duke’s!

What kind of ice cream is in the Hula Pie?

The famous Hula Pie is crafted with the perfectly sweet macadamia nut ice cream.
